+#elif defined(__aarch64__) && defined(__ARM_NEON)
+/*
+ * We use the Neon instructions if the compiler provides access to them (as
+ * indicated by __ARM_NEON) and we are on aarch64. While Neon support is
+ * technically optional for aarch64, it appears that all available 64-bit
+ * hardware does have it. Neon exists in some 32-bit hardware too, but we
+ * could not realistically use it there without a run-time check, which seems
+ * not worth the trouble for now.
+ */
+#include <arm_neon.h>
+#define USE_NEON
+typedef uint8x16_t Vector8;
+typedef uint32x4_t Vector32;
